Windows File Recovery Stuck at 99% or 0%? Fix WINFR Stuck Issues Now
If Windows File Recovery (WINFR) gets stuck at 99%, 0%, or fails to complete, it could be due to disk errors, insufficient permissions, or corrupted files. This guide covers troubleshooting steps like running CHKDSK, adjusting scan parameters and using alternative recovery tools to resolve freezing issues and recover lost data.
Windows File Recovery Stuck at 99%!
I'm trying to recover mistakenly deleted large files, total size around 20 GB, from drive D: (a hard drive) to drive I: (an external drive with 72 GB free space). I started winfr last week. Pass 1: Scanning and processing disk Scanning disk: 0%. It took about 60 hours until to reach 99%: Scanning disk: 99%. After another one and half day, it was still at 99%: Scanning disk: 99%.What is it doing?What can i do to get rid of this and recover files?
Windows File Recovery is a command-line utility developed by Microsoft to help users recover lost or deleted files from various storage devices. Unlike graphical recovery tools, it operates through the Command Prompt, making it suitable for advanced users who need precise control over the recovery process. The tool supports multiple file systems, including NTFS, FATand exFAT, and can recover data from hard drives, SSDs, USB drives, and memory cards.
Possible Cause of Windows File Recovery Stuck at 99% or 0%
Windows File Recovery getting stuck at 99% or 0% can be frustrating, and several factors may contribute to this issue.
- File System Corruption or Bad Sectors: Damaged file systems or bad blocks on the drive can cause the recovery process to freeze when attempting to read corrupted data.
- Insufficient System Resources (Low RAM/CPU/Disk I/O): Limited memory, high CPU usage, or slow disk access can prevent the tool from completing the scan.Background applications (e.g., antivirus, disk utilities) may interfere with recovery.
- Failing or Physically Damaged Storage Device: A dying HDD/SSD with mechanical issues or degraded NAND cells can cause freezes.Frequent disconnections or unstable USB connections may interrupt recovery.
- Incorrect Command Parameters or Recovery Mode: Using the wrong scan mode (Default/Segment/Signature) for the file system can lead to freezing.Overly broad filters (e.g., *.*) or incorrect paths may cause excessive processing.
- Overwritten or Highly Fragmented Files: If deleted files are partially overwritten or scattered across the disk, recovery may stall.
- Software Conflicts (Antivirus): Security software may lock files or block deep disk access.
- Large or Encrypted Drives: Scanning very large drives (e.g., 4TB+) may take excessively long, appearing stuck.Besides, encrypted drives (BitLocker) are unsupported and may cause failures.
How to Fix “Windows File Recovery Stuck at 99%”?
When Windows File Recovery (Winfr) gets stuck at 99% or 0%, it can be incredibly frustrating, especially when you're trying to recover important files. This comprehensive guide will walk you through all possible solutions, from basic troubleshooting to advanced recovery techniques.
1. Wait Longer (Especially for Large Drives)
The tool may appear frozen but could still be processing, especially on large or slow drives. Wait at least 2–4 hours before assuming it’s stuck.
2. Try Another USB Port/PC
If the Winfr stuck 99% when recovering files from SD card, USB drive or other external drives, you can try a different USB port, cables or even computer.
3. Run CHKDSK to Fix Disk Errors
Corrupted sectors or file system errors can cause freezing. Thus, you can run CHKDSK tool to check the file system and file system metadata of a volume for logical and physical errors.
Step 1. Search for "cmd" in the Windows Start menu.
Step 2. Right-click "Command Prompt" and select "Run as administrator".
Step 3. Type the following command and press Enter:
chkdsk g: /f /r
g:: Replace "g:" with the letter of the drive you want to check (e.g., D:, E:).
/f: This option tells CHKDSK to fix any errors it finds.
/r: This option tells CHKDSK to locate bad sectors and recover readable information.
4. Close Background Apps
When your system has low RAM, high CPU usage, or slow disk I/O that's interfering with file recovery, try these solutions:
Close unnecessary applications via Task Manager (Windows) or Activity Monitor (Mac). Especially close resource-heavy programs like video editors, games, or multiple browser tabs.
Free up disk space by deleting temporary files, clearingbrowser caches, and movinglarge files to external storage if possible.
5. Temporarily Disable Antivirus
If your Windows File Recovery tool freezes near completionlike stuck 99%because of antivirus interference, you can temporarily Disable Antivirus. For example, turn off Windows Defender:
Step 1. Press Win + I → Update & Security → Windows Security → Virus & Threat Protection → Manage Settings.
Step 2. Under the “Real-time Protection”, toggle the "Real-time protection" switch to the "off" position.
6. Use a Different Recovery Mode
IfWindows File Recovery gets stuck at 99%, you can change the recovery mode and use another one.
- Default mode (for recently deleted files on NTFS): Winfr C: D: /regular /n \Users\\Documents\
- Segment mode (for FAT/exFAT or deeper scans): winfr C: D: /segment/n \Projects\*.xlsx /r
- Extensivemode (for severely damaged drives): winfr H: D: \text /extensive
7. Use Alternative Recovery Tools
If "Windows File Recovery (Winfr) stuck at 99%" issue persists after the above solutions,please consideralternative recovery tool to totally bypass this error. We recommend using free MyRecover, a more reliable and user-friendly alternative that bypasses Winfr’s limitations.
🔥🔥Why Choose MyRecover Over Winfr?
✅ No Command Line Needed – Simple GUI (graphical interface) for easy file recovery.
✅ Higher Success Rate – Advanced deep scan for NTFS/FAT32/exFAT drives.
✅ Smart Filtering – Recover files by type, date, or size with precision.
✅Wide Device Support- Recover files from all types of devices like SSD, HDD, USB flash drive, SD card, cameras and more.
✅Handle More Data Loss Scenarios: Recover from deleted or formatted partition, emptied Recycle Bin, system crash, virus attack, etc.
✅ OS Compatibility– Work not only on Windows 11 /10, but also on Windows 8.1/ 8/ 7 and all Servers.
How to Use MyRecover
Step 1: Download and installMyRecover on your Computer. Avoid installing it on the drive from which you are recovering lost files.
Step 2: Double-click the software icon to launch it. Select the target drive and click on “Scan”.
Step 3: For recently deleted files, it will perform a “Quick Scan”by default. If you are trying to recover files from formatted or corrupted drives, it will start a “Deep Scan” instead.
Step 4: After the scanning process is finished, select files and click Click "Recover".
Step 5. Choosea different drive tosave the recovered file, which will avoid overwriting.
If you want to preview files before recovery, please use Professional edition.
In Conclusion
After exploring all potential causes and solutions for Windows File Recovery stuck at 99%, it's clear that this Microsoft tool has significant limitations when dealing withsome complex data loss cases. If you want to get rid of the issue in the future, try MyRecover to recover data on your storage device.
Besides, it also comes with another two advanced editions for different users. If you are trying to recover files from computer that cannot boot up as usual, or planning to use the software on unlimited computers like all devices in one company, switch to Professional or Technician version.